San Diego is located in California. San Diego, California 92105has a population of 1,401,996. San Diego 92105 is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 25.08% households with children. The county percentage for households with children is 29%.
The median household income in San Diego, California 92105 is $84,815. The median household income for the surrounding county is $83,628 compared to the national median of $66,222. The median age of people living in San Diego 92105 is 37.4 years.
The average high temperature in July is 78.42 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 46.45 degrees. The annual precipitation is 11.4.
